ABSTRACT
In the recent years transportation projects in India have created excessive noise pollution which is displeasing the activity or
balance of human and animal life. Noise health effects are both health and behavioral in nature. Noise can damage
physiological and psychological health of human being. Noise pollution can cause annoyance and aggression, hypertension,
high stress levels, hearing loss, sleep disturbances. Amaravati is a second largest and important city in Vidharbha region. As
Amaravati is developing area and a good education centre is a rapid urbanization and alarming growth of population is
causing serious environmental problems. Noise is one of the environmental problem that uncomforts in daily life. In the
present study for recording the various noise parameter digital sound meter was used. Traffic volume data was also collected on
the express highway. The variation in noise level and traffic volume data are studied and presented in the graphical form for
the selected location. The study also includes the remedial measures for the management of noise. |
